The Word "affection" originates from the Latin Word "affectio," which means "a putting on, a bringing about, or a disposition." It is derived from "afficere," meaning "to do something to" or "to influence." The term made its way into Middle English via Old French, reflecting the idea of emotional attachment or fondness towards someone or something. Over time, it has come to denote warm feelings of love and care.
